Mentoring, Job Rotation and<br />

Attachments<br />

Description: Mentoring involves the use <strong>of</strong><br />

experienced staff to provide individualized<br />

support to other staff with less experience with<br />

the goal <strong>of</strong> pr<strong>of</strong>essional and personal<br />

development. This type <strong>of</strong> initiative could be<br />

used to train individuals who are preparing to<br />

take on a leadership role or those who may need<br />

to develop a specific skill or competency. Job<br />

rotation, shadowing or attachments are job<br />

design techniques in which employees are<br />

moved between two or more jobs in a planned<br />

manner. The objective is to expose the<br />

employees to different experiences and wider<br />

variety <strong>of</strong> skills to enhance job satisfaction and<br />

to cross-train them within their MDA or across<br />

MDAs. These types <strong>of</strong> initiatives could also be<br />

used to develop core competencies.<br />

Target Audience: This is suitable for<br />

developing the core competencies but can also be<br />

used for any <strong>of</strong> the <strong>ICT</strong> Job Families.<br />

Requirements and Qualifications: No prerequisites<br />

for this type <strong>of</strong> training.<br />

Supply Chain Management<br />

Description: Individuals in the <strong>ICT</strong> group<br />

responsible for sourcing and purchasing may<br />

want to obtain training in supply management.<br />

This would develop the skills necessary for the<br />

GoJ to manage the entire sourcing and<br />

purchasing cycle for <strong>ICT</strong> related goods that are<br />

needed to ensure that projects that depend on<br />

these goods are not adversely impacted.<br />

<strong>Training</strong> in this area can be as extensive as the<br />

certified pr<strong>of</strong>essional in supply management<br />

(CPSM) <strong>of</strong>fered by the Institute for Supply<br />

Management (ISM). However, this could be<br />

done in partnership with other tertiary<br />

institutions that customize training for the<br />

specific situations in <strong>Jamaica</strong>. In addition, inhouse<br />

training from the procurement<br />

department in the GoJ may also need to provide<br />

continuous training on the <strong>Jamaica</strong> Procurement<br />

Guidelines for <strong>ICT</strong> staff. This too may require<br />

some customization for <strong>ICT</strong> specific sourcing if<br />

necessary.<br />

Target Audience: individuals who are primarily<br />

involved in the operational side <strong>of</strong> purchasing<br />

will benefit from this type <strong>of</strong> training.<br />

Particularly <strong>ICT</strong> roles in the F08 Job Family are<br />

the main target for this type <strong>of</strong> training.<br />

Requirements and Qualifications: Any <strong>ICT</strong><br />

staff could take part in this training with zero<br />

knowledge <strong>of</strong> the topics.<br />

Six Sigma<br />

Description: Six Sigma is an integrated,<br />

disciplined, and proven approach for improving<br />

business performance. Six Sigma's focus on<br />

quality complements Lean techniques focused on<br />

efficiencies; and, when combined, these skills<br />

promote business and operational excellence.<br />

Knowledge and skills developed in this type <strong>of</strong><br />

training aids organizations and businesses<br />

improve production and minimize inefficiencies<br />

from every product, process, and customer<br />

transaction.<br />
